What Affects the SGD to BOB Rate

Exchange rates between Singapore Dollar and Bolivian Boliviano are influenced by central bank interest rate decisions, inflation differentials, trade balances, and broader economic data releases from both countries. Political stability, commodity prices, and global risk sentiment can also cause significant moves. Monitoring these factors helps explain why the SGD/BOB rate fluctuates throughout trading sessions and over longer time periods.

How to Get the Best SGD to BOB Rate

To minimize conversion costs, compare the rate offered by your bank or transfer service against the mid-market rate shown on this page. Online money transfer services and fintech apps often provide rates 2-3% better than traditional banks. For larger amounts, the savings from finding a competitive rate can be substantial. Always check the total cost including both the exchange rate markup and any fixed fees charged by the provider.

Singapore Dollar Overview

The Singapore Dollar (SGD) is the official currency of Singapore, managed by the Monetary Authority of Singapore through a trade-weighted band system. It reflects one of Asia's strongest and most stable economies. Understanding the fundamentals behind SGD helps contextualize its exchange rate movements against BOB and other currencies.

BOB
BOB - Bolivian Boliviano
The Bolivian Boliviano (BOB) is the official currency of Bolivia. Natural gas exports and mining (lithium, silver, zinc) are the primary foreign exchange sources.
